Discover the Charm of Kissimmee's Flea Markets

Nestled just 15 minutes away from the iconic Disney World, Kissimmee offers a delightful escape for shoppers and food enthusiasts alike. Among its many attractions, the Visitors Flea Market stands out as a must-visit destination. This flea market in Kissimmee boasts over 225 vendor booths within a sprawling 50,000 sq ft air-conditioned space, making it a perfect spot to hunt for bargains and unique finds.

With over 1.2 million visitors each year, it's no wonder that the market is a beloved landmark for both tourists and locals. Whether you're searching for budget-friendly Disney souvenirs, handmade crafts, or vintage collectibles, the Visitors Flea Market provides an array of options to satisfy any shopper's desires. Plus, with free admission and parking, it's an accessible and enjoyable experience for everyone.

A Culinary Adventure: Food Trucks in Kissimmee

Adjacent to the bustling flea market, the World Food Trucks park offers a vibrant culinary experience that complements your shopping adventure. With over 100 food trucks, it's a haven for food lovers looking to explore diverse flavors. From savory street tacos to sweet crepes, the food trucks in Kissimmee cater to every palate.

Why Visit the Visitors Flea Market?

With its convenient location near Disney World, the Visitors Flea Market is an ideal stop for families and groups looking to explore the Orlando area. It's open 365 days a year, so no matter when you plan your visit, you can enjoy its offerings. The market's pet-friendly policy and regular live entertainment, including car shows, add to its appeal as a family-friendly destination.
